  • Patent number: 9831245
    Abstract: A complementary logic device includes i) a substrate, ii) a first semiconductor device located on the substrate and including a first channel layer, a carrier supply layer for supplying a carrier to the channel layer, and an upper cladding layer and a lower cladding layer respectively located at upper and lower portions of the channel layer, iii) a second semiconductor device located on the substrate and including a structure the same or similar to that of the first semiconductor device, iv) a source electrode located on the two semiconductors and made of a ferromagnetic body, v) a drain electrode located on the two semiconductors and made of a ferromagnetic body, and vi) a gate electrode located on the two semiconductors and located between the two electrodes so that a gate voltage is applied thereto to control a spin of electrons passing through the two channel layers.

  • Publication number: 20170018625
    Abstract: Disclosed is a transistor including a topological insulator. The transistor includes: a substrate; a topological insulator provided on the substrate; a drain electrode provided on the topological insulator; a source electrode separated from the drain electrode, provided on the topological insulator, and including a ferromagnetic substance; a tunnel junction layer provided on the source electrode; and a gate electrode provided on the tunnel junction layer. A spin direction of the topological insulator is fixed by a current flowing to a surface thereof, and a spin direction of the source electrode is changed to a predetermined direction by a voltage applied to the gate electrode.

  • Patent number: 9226403
    Abstract: In accordance with the present disclosure, a hybrid electronic sheet which exhibits superior electrical property and allows biomaterial functionalization and flexible device patterning may be provided by binding a graphitic material in colloidal state to a biomaterial capable of binding thereto specifically and nondestructively. Since the electronic sheet is an electronic sheet wherein a biomaterial and an electrical material (graphitic material) are hybridized, it exhibits good compatibility with biomaterials and can be further functionalized with, for example, an enzyme that selectively reacts with a biochemical substance. Accordingly, an electrical material and a chemical or biological material may be effectively nanostructurized and it can be realized as a multi-functional, high-performance electronic sheet.
